Classify different parenting styles
Children's future and manners especially depend on their parents' controlling and
managing methods and styles. It is important that the way the parents interact and how they
discipline to their children because it will influence the rest of the children's life. In theory,
parenting styles are analyzed with four different categories: authoritarian parent, permissive
parent, authoritative parent, and neglecting parent. Authoritarian parenting is an extremely strict
parenting style. They never consider the children's point of view and they believe that strict rules
are important to make their children well-behaved and fit into the society. Moreover, they don't
typically explain about the strict rules and rationale explanations or listen and give an opportunity
for the children to express their feelings. The second type of parenting method is permissive
parenting style. These types of parents never say "no" to their children and they never control
and attempt to discipline their children . They struggle to set rules and expectations for behavior
on their children. Authoritative parents are characterized by high responsiveness and high
expectations of their kids. They respect their children's needs and set firm limits for their
children. They attempt to control children's behavior by explaining rules and rational
reasoning. They listen to a children's viewpoint but don't always accept it. The final type
of parenting is neglecting parents. They particularly don't respond to their children's
needs, grades and desires. They barely show little interest in their children and never
give advice or motivation, In my opinion, perhaps there are many types of parenting
stvles that can rear children. For good parenting, parents have to ensure the balance of demandingness and responsiveness.
